    When I Was Me

    Once I knew how it felt to sweat every day,
    From vigorous labor and virile play,
    But my bones have been broken,
    And my flesh has become rotten.
    The golden promise of a young man,
    Has been torn from my crippled hands,
    For as I turned my head in distraction,
    Everything I was and dreamed died.

    How could I have known how precious it was,
    When it was all that I had ever known.
    Now I can only bend my sore and crippled neck,
    And dream of dreaming and running and dreaming.
    Every rock and hill and tree and river was a challenge,
    Goading me and inviting me to conquer it.
    Every defeat was only motivation to try harder,
    And every victory was an open door to another challenge.

    Oh God! If only I had my health and youth again!
    I would run faster, and punch harder, and jump higher!
    I would read more, and write more, and study more!
    I would love deeper, and forgive all, and be kinder!
    I would be braver, and fight harder, and never compromise!
    If only I had my health and youth again,
    I would be me…only more.
